WebJan 27, 2024 · Downforce is awesome for race cars: It puts more force on each tire, giving more traction, without adding much mass to the car. A car with 1000 pounds of downforce has the traction of a car that’s 1000 pounds heavier, but it only has to use that traction to accelerate the additional mass of the aerodynamic devices added. Downforce helps provide the necessary … WebJun 22, 2016 · Downforce is generated at a squared rate relative to speed, so if a car doubles in speed, the amount of downforce it generates will quadruple (a car that generates 1,000 pounds of downforce at 100 mph will generate 4,000 pounds of downforce at 200 mph). The faster you go, the more downforce (and drag) you make, at an increasing rate.
